Did you know?

The largest baby ever born weighed more than 23 pounds but died just 11 hours after his birth in 1879. The largest surviving baby was born in October 2009 in Sumatra, Indonesia, and weighed an astounding 19.2 pounds at birth.

Did you know?

When blood is exposed to air, it clots. Heparin allows the blood to come in direct contact with air without clotting.

Did you know?

Patients who have undergone chemotherapy for the treatment of cancer often complain of a lack of mental focus; memory loss; and a general diminution in abilities such as multitasking, attention span, and general mental agility.
